WebThis policy setting allows you to control whether Smart Card Plug and Play is enabled. If you enable or do not configure this policy setting, Smart Card Plug and Play will be enabled and the system will attempt to install a Smart Card device driver when a card is inserted in a Smart Card Reader for the first time. Well it appears that there is a group policy in Windows 10 under Computer Configuration>Administrative Templates>System>Logon, and set the value in Assign a default credential provider to {8FD7E19C-3BF7-489B-A72C-846AB3678C96} which is the smart card provider. This does appear to make smart card the default logon provider at … WebThe following tasks detail the Smart Card middleware policy settings: ... WebMar 3, 2024 · Method 2: Registry Editor Locate the registry path: H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\policies\system. … WebInteractive logon: Smart card removal behavior. This security setting determines what happens when the smart card for a logged-on user is removed from the smart card reader. The options are: No Action. Lock Workstation. Force Logoff. Disconnect if a Remote Desktop Services session. If you click Lock Workstation in the Properties dialog box for ...
